What is an Integrated Oven?
An integrated Oven Integrated is developed to be perfectly incorporated into kitchen cabinetry, leading to a sleek and orderly appearance. Unlike traditional standalone integral electric ovens that occupy a distinct space and interfere with the flow of kitchen style, integrated ovens blend into the kitchen cabinetry, offering a structured appearance. They are available in various styles, consisting of single and double ovens, and can be matched with induction hobs, warming drawers, or other kitchen appliances.

There are a number of types of integrated ovens that customers can pick from, each with distinct functionalities:
1. Single Integrated Ovens
Single integrated ovens are ideal for smaller sized cooking areas or for those who require fundamental cooking abilities. These ovens normally offer enough cooking area for everyday use without unnecessary complexity.
2. Double Integrated Ovens
For avid cooks or bigger families, double integrated ovens supply additional cooking capability. Including 2 different compartments, these ovens enable simultaneous cooking of several meals at various temperature levels.
3. Steam Ovens
Steam ovens are a special choice that makes use of steam to cook food. This method maintains nutrients and tastes, making them a much healthier choice for stews, vegetables, and desserts.
4. Combination Ovens
These flexible appliances combine a microwave and a standard oven, providing the benefits of both cooking methods. They make it possible for fast cooking times in addition to the ability to bake and roast.
5. Wall Ovens
Wall ovens are created to be built straight into the wall, making them quickly accessible. They are perfect for those who choose elevated cooking spaces.
